Paddy Pimblett expects Conor McGregor to make a major impact at UFC 329.
The 31-year-old Liverpool-born fighter faces Benoit Saint Denis in a lightweight fight at the same event.
## What does Paddy Pimblett think about Conor McGregor's return?
Paddy Pimblett never thought Conor McGregor would retire after his losses to Dustin Poirier in 2021.
Conor McGregor suffered back-to-back defeats to Dustin Poirier at UFC 264 and UFC 257 in 2021.
The Irishman has been out of action since 2021 and will face Max Holloway at UFC 329 on July 11.

## What's next for Paddy Pimblett and Conor McGregor?
Paddy Pimblett will face Benoit Saint Denis in a lightweight fight at UFC 329.
Conor McGregor will face Max Holloway in the co-main event at UFC 329 on July 11.
The event will take place at the T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as.
